What does Mateo mean?

Mateo means "gift of Yahweh"

How do we pronounce Mateo?

Mateo \ma-teo, mat-eo\ is a boy's name. It consists of 5 letters and 3 syllables.

The baby boy name Mateo is pronounced Maa-T-ow- 1.

1 Pronunciation for Mateo: M as in "me (M.IY)" ; AA as in "odd (AA.D)" ; T as in "tee (T.IY)" ; OW as in "oak (OW.K)"

What is the origin of Mateo?

Mateo's language of origin is Hebrew. It is used predominantly in English and Spanish. Mateo is a variant form of the English Matthew meaning of name. Mateo is a popular baby boy name, and it regarded as trendy. The name has been increasing in popularity since the 1990s; prior to that, it was of only very light use. At the modest height of its usage in 2010, 0.079% of baby boys were named Mateo. It had a ranking of #221 then.
